Abstract
The invention discloses a kind of antibacterial water tanks, including cabinet;Top of the box is provided with opening, inner hollow, and box house is nested with liner identical with body structure;Inner bladder outer wall is provided with electro-insulating rubber layer, and liner uses the titanium material by differential arc oxidation, and liner inner wall is coated with the electroactive fungistatic coating of stannic oxide-ruthenic oxide;Insulation rubber sleeve outside circumference ring-wound has several circle electric wires, and electric wire both ends are connected separately with power positive cathode.Electric field can be formed when energization to carry out electro photoluminescence to the electroactive fungistatic coating of stannic oxide-ruthenic oxide and activate coating bacteriostatic activity, not only realized bacteriostasis, and realize the controllability of fungistatic effect, helped to be adjusted for different demands.

Specific embodiment
The invention will be described in further detail with reference to the accompanying drawing:
Shown in Figure 1, antibacterial water tank of the present invention includes cabinet 2, coil 3, electro-insulating rubber layer 4 from outside to inside
With liner 5, cabinet 2, electro-insulating rubber layer 4 are identical with 5 structure of liner, are that top is provided with opening, inner hollow, liner 5
Internal cavity is sterilization chamber.
The cabinet 2 of water tank is jacket type structure, and inner wall circumferential surface is provided with several circle grooves, groove generally shape of threads,
For placing coil 3, coil 3 is protected not to be worn, positive pole and power cathode are connected with groove both ends respectively, coil 3
It is electro-insulating rubber layer 4 between sterilization chamber.
4 outer wrap loop coil 3 of electro-insulating rubber layer, coil 3 are in insulation rubber sleeve outside circumference ring-wound at several
The electric wire of circle, electric wire both ends are separately connected power positive cathode, and supply voltage is greater than 0V, and is less than or equal to 50V, opens when opening power supply
Guan Hou, it is electroactive antibacterial to the stannic oxide-ruthenic oxide on 5 surface of differential arc oxidation titanium liner which will generate an electric field
Coating carries out electro photoluminescence, activates the bacteriostatic activity of the electroactive fungistatic coating of stannic oxide-ruthenic oxide.
Liner 5 is coated with the electroactive suppression of stannic oxide-ruthenic oxide using the titanium material for passing through differential arc oxidation, 5 inner wall of liner
Bacterium coating, the electroactive fungistatic coating of stannic oxide-ruthenic oxide with a thickness of 5-50 μm, 5 material of liner be TA2 industrially pure titanium,
TA3 industrially pure titanium, TA4 industrially pure titanium or TC4 titanium alloy, the electroactive fungistatic coating of stannic oxide-ruthenic oxide is by generating work
The chemical modes attack bacterias such as property oxygen, to reach to bacterial growth Reproduction suppression.Test of many times surface, as long as guaranteeing water tank not
Power-off can be achieved with that bacterial growth is inhibited to increase and eliminate peculiar smell.
The lid 1 that can be opened and closed is provided at the top of cabinet 2, lid 1 and 2 upper edge of cabinet are hinged, can by this upper cover to
Injection tap water etc. carries out storage in liner 5 and lid 1 is closed after injecting water, case can be effectively prevented by antibacterial taste removal
The extraneous dust of body 2 and bacterium enter in water.
